- the invention relates to a dishwasher having a substantially cuboidal or parallelepipedic, open to the front housing and with an open-top washing container whose side walls have upper edges which extend parallel to the housing cover, and which can be pulled drawer-like for loading and unloading from the housing and during the flushing operation is completely inserted into the housing, wherein abut the edges of the housing cover or at least one parallel thereto directed sealing surface under any intermediate position of at least one seal during the flushing operation.
- Such a dishwasher is known for example from WO 98/33426 A1.
- the advantages of such a drawer dishwasher are described in detail in this document.
- a problem with drawer dishwashers arises from the need to seal the open-topped rinse tank to prevent leakage of rinse liquid.
- a liquid-tight contact must be made between the cover of the housing - or parallel sealing strips on the housing side walls - and the edges that define the Spülakutician.
- flexible seals are used at the edges and / or on the housing.
- one of the sealing partners must exert one force on the other. In the rear area, this force is achieved by the insertion movement, which is perpendicular to the sealing edge. At the lateral edges, however, the insertion movement runs parallel to the two sealing edges. Provision must therefore be made to produce a force having a perpendicular component to the lateral sealing edges.
- WO 98/33426 A1 uses a washing container which is higher in the front than behind, so that the edges of the side walls are inclined backwards. In a correspondingly inclined extending cover or a corresponding sealing strip is then achieved that the insertion movement is no longer parallel to the sealing edge and thus generates a force on the seal partners. From the oblique course of the edges, there are several disadvantages. On the one hand, the height of the washing container decreases, which is the same Reduced capacity. On the other hand running on the inclined edges standing residual water to the rear in the housing.
- WO 98/33426 A1 discloses variants with folding lids or "endless lids" mounted on rollers, which, however, have disadvantages in terms of their tightness.
- the lowering by seals by inflating the seal itself or an associated activating device is described in WO 98/33426 A1.
- the invention poses the problem of creating a structurally simple, yet functionally reliable way of sealing the rinsing container within the housing.
- the achievable with the present invention consist in the simple structure of housing and washing, in particular, the cuboid shape or parallelepiped shape of the washing can be maintained.
- rails which are arranged laterally on the housing and / or on the washing container and whose distance from the housing cover or from the upper edges of the side walls in the rear region is less than in the front region are used as the drawer guide.
- the housing is equipped with a free space located under the washing compartment.
- a particularly advantageous embodiment is characterized by a device which increases in the position of use, the front portion of the housing relative to the rear region. As a result, the movement of the washing container is shifted back into the horizontal, so that only small forces are necessary for insertion of the container into the housing and also an automatic movement of the container is avoided.
- the dishwasher 1 shown in FIGS. 1 to 3 has a rinsing container 2 which can be pulled out of the housing 3 in a drawer-like manner for loading and unloading.
- the container 2 is arranged in a substantially cuboid or parallelepipedic housing 3, which is designed to be open to the front side 4.
- a free space 5 is provided in the area below the washing compartment 2.
- the housing 3 is made of metal.
- the washing container 2 is also cuboid or parallelepipedisch and open at the top. This has the consequence that an upper edge 8 is formed on each wall.
- the rear wall 9 preferably has the same height as the side walls 10, but it may also have a small height offset.
- the front wall 11 is preferably formed higher than the side walls 10 and projects beyond the housing cover 12, it can be covered in a known manner by a decorative plate (not shown).
- the basic requirement for the inventive design of the dishwasher is merely that the edges 8 of the side walls 10 extend parallel to the housing cover 12.
- the container 2 is made of plastic, it may be made for example as a one-piece plastic injection molded part.
- recesses 13 are arranged for receiving the inner guides 14 of the telescopic rails. The connection of the inner guides 14 with the side walls 10 can be done in a known manner by screws, molded pins or latching hooks and is not shown in the drawings.
- the abutment region is the upper edges 8 of the side walls 10 and the rear wall 9 sealed to the housing cover 12.
- a circumferential seal 15 is attached to the housing cover 12.
- the seal 15 may be attached to the underside of a sealing strip (not shown) arranged on the side walls 10 and / or the rear wall 9. It can also be provided for each wall a single seal 15.
- the use of a seal 15 on the housing cover 12 on the one hand offers the advantage that it remains hidden and therefore protected from damage, for example by falling cutlery.
- hypotenuse 15b is directed in an advantageous manner to the inside of the rim 8, so that water dripping from the seal 15 flows into the washing container 2.
- a labyrinth effect is generated by the projecting tip 15c, which protects the edge 8 from direct exposure to rinsing liquid.
- the telescopic rails are attached to the housing 3 and the washing container 2 such that their distance d from the housing cover or from the upper edges of the side walls in the rear region is less than the distance D in the front region.
- the drawer guide of the washing compartment 2 extends obliquely with respect to the housing cover 12 or the edges 8 in such a way that the upper edges are raised from the bottom level to the seals 15 during the insertion process from a lower level to the system level required for flushing operation.
- the above-described attachment of the telescopic rails would lead to an automatic opening of the washing compartment 2 and to an increased effort when closing.
- a device is provided which increases in the position of use, the front portion of the housing 3 relative to the rear region. In practice, these may be front feet 17 extended from the rear 18. Alternatively, frame parts (not shown) are conceivable which guarantee this function.
